Output 218e84e6ef6b3e9c29d03bbdb791844d4b2e379dd4963fcd48c9fcd435d56308:45

value
49720596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f462ed82678700cdf8899e28737aea02c7cc49fa OP_EQUAL
address
3PyDJyMSykctW6RxfapoxNhBdNWKZgMhwA
transaction
218e84e6ef6b3e9c29d03bbdb791844d4b2e379dd4963fcd48c9fcd435d56308
spent
true